amazing but Where this Relations come from? Why E=Kq/r² and B=u I /( r . 2Pi ) ? Why one of this Related to r and other one related to r² why B related to 1 / 2pi ??
@MichelvanBiezen6 жыл бұрын
All your questions are answered in the playlists leading up to the one on Maxwell's equations. May I suggest you study that material first before tackling Maxwell's equations.
@carultch2 жыл бұрын
E=K*q/r^2 has r^2 because the field spreads out in 3-dimensional space, from a point source of the field, the charge q. If you write K in the "OOFPEZ" form, as 1/(4*pi*epsilon0), then you will see that 4*pi*r^2 appears in the denominator, indicating the area of a sphere. B=mu*I/(2*pi*r) has r on its own, because it is the way a magnetic field spreads out in 3-dimensional space from a linear source of the magnetic field, a long straight wire. Notice that 2*pi*r is the circumference of the circle at a distance r from a wire.

How did we get the constants ε0 and the other one
@MichelvanBiezen5 жыл бұрын
The permittivity and permeability of free space were experimentally determined. Note that Maxwell determined that 1/sqrt(Eo x Uo) equals the speed of light.
